The Palestinian Prisoners Club reported that the Israeli occupation forces had arrested 200 Palestinians in Jenin in the West Bank since the beginning of this year, more than half of them were arrested last March.
The Prisoner Club said in a statement today, carried by Wafa Agency, that the arrests were concentrated in Jenin camp, and the detainees' ages ranged between 18 and 35 years, and a large percentage of them were subjected to repeated arrests over the past years.
The club pointed out that, during the past years, the occupation forces escalated their attacks on the city of Jenin, which witnessed a noticeable increase in the rate of arrests since late last year and the beginning of this year, compared to previous periods.
The club pointed out that the number of prisoners from the city of Jenin who are in Israeli detention reached 500, including 10 children and 3 women.
Since mid-March, the occupation forces have launched daily raids on Jenin refugee camp, which resulted in the death and injury of a number of Palestinians, and the demolition of several homes.
